Sex, Lies and Six Hidden Kids: Saga of the Once China’s Richest Man
In China's business history, never had a man's public image was shattered completely after his death like Zong Qinghou, a beverage magnate. He played the card of patriotism and distanced himself from the United States by fuelling nationalism, which he used to his business advantage. But recent revelations show that he had a massive luxury mansion in California and a few extramarital kids who grew up in the U.S.
